
Sala Tuinabua
Sala Tuinabua, a Leadership & Management Specialist, empowers emerging leaders, guides seasoned professionals, and champions intentional leadership in the marketplace.
She is passionate about equipping and training leaders to reach their full potential. Author of Jewels in the Crown. Sala is from Fiji and has lived in the USA, Fiji and currently resides in Auckland, NZ.
Area of Expertise: Leadership in Marketplace, Faith Based, Women and Family

Christine(Chris) Nurminen has a pioneering spirit and is a Pacific development executive with extensive governance and management experience in the not-for-profit sector in Aotearoa New Zealand. She is Tongan and the Director of Manava Partners – a consultancy she and her sister co-founded based on seeing the need to support Pacific women to lead. Using her MA(Hons) in Education, Chris has served as a CEO for a Crown-appointed charity, served as Chair on various charitable Boards and she now consults Pacific organizations to support strategy, funding and professional development. Chris values partnerships and the interface between Pacific and Māori women in protecting Pacific languages and cultural identities. She is married with two young children and is a published children’s book author.


Katrina Ma'u Fatiaki is a Leadership and Human Rights Specialist with more than 20 years of experience serving in regional organisations, civil society and government. She was appointed in 2025 as a Public Service Commissioner under the Tonga Public Service Act 2002, mandated to oversee recruitment, appointments, promotions, discipline, and performance management across 16 Ministries and 4 agencies.
